containers:- name: metrics-server image: k8s.gcr.io/metrics-server-amd64:v0.3.1imagePullPolicy: Always command:- /metrics-server- --kubelet-insecure-tls- --kubelet-preferred-address-types=InternalIP,Hostname,InternalDNS,ExternalDNS,ExternalIP volumeMounts:- name: tmp-dirmountPath:/tmp nodeSelec...
HorizontalPodAutoscaler 的能力完全基于 Metrics Server,它从 Metrics Server 获取当前应用的运行指标,主要是 CPU 使用率,再依据预定的策略增加或者减少 Pod 的数量。 Prometheus 系统的核心是它的 Server,里面有一个时序数据库 TSDB,用来存储监控数据,另一个组件 Retrieval 使用拉取(Pull)的方式从各个目标收集数据,再...
其实,所谓的 Exporter,就是代替被监控对象来对 Prometheus 暴露出可以被“抓取”的 Metrics 信息的一个辅助进程。 而Node Exporter 可以暴露给 Prometheus 采集的 Metrics 数据, 也不单单是节点的负载(Load)、CPU 、内存、磁盘以及网络这样的常规信息,它的...
k8s全栈监控之metrics-server和prometheus k8s全栈监控之metrics-server和prometheus ⼀、概述 使⽤metric-server收集数据给k8s集群内使⽤,如kubectl,hpa,scheduler等 使⽤prometheus-operator部署prometheus,存储监控数据 使⽤kube-state-metrics收集k8s集群内资源对象数据 使⽤node_exporter收集集群中各节点的数据 ...
为什么在创建Grafana大盘时,没有Kubelet和API Server的监控指标? 为什么Exporter对应的大盘看不到具体的指标? 为什么Pod被删除后,Deployment大盘中可以筛选到Pod信息,而Pod大盘则不行? 其他 首页应用实时监控服务ARMS可观测监控 Prometheus 版服务支持常见问题大盘相关为什么在创建Grafana大盘...
1 Metrics-server是一个集群级组件,它通过Summary API定期从Kubelet服务的所有Kubernetes节点中获取容器CPU和内存使用指标。 Kubelet导出一个“摘要”API,它聚合了来自所有吊舱的统计数据。 $ kubectl proxy & Starting to serve on 127.0.0.1:8001 $ NODE=$(kubectl get nodes -o=jsonpath="{.items[0].metadata....
使用prometheus收集apiserver,scheduler,controller-manager,kubelet组件数据 使用alertmanager实现监控报警 使用grafana实现数据可视化 1、部署metrics-server git clone https://github.com/cuishuaigit/k8s-monitor.gitcd k8s-monitor 我都是把这种服务部署在master节点上面,此时需要修改metrics-server-deployment.yaml ...
K8S安装prometheus+kube-state-metrics+grafana 2019-12-08 02:53 − k8s安装Prometheus+Grafana: 1.在kubernetest集群中创建namespace: [root@master k8s-promethus]# cat namespace.yaml apiVersion: v1 kind: Namespace metadata: name... ccbky 2 2571 k8s-prometheus监控 2019-12-25 19:29 − ...
使用prometheus收集apiserver,scheduler,controller-manager,kubelet组件数据 使用alertmanager实现监控报警 使用grafana实现数据可视化 1、部署metrics-server git clone https://github.com/cuishuaigit/k8s-monitor.git cd k8s-monitor 我都是把这种服务部署在master节点上面,此时需要修改metrics-server-deployment.yaml ...
使用prometheus收集apiserver,scheduler,controller-manager,kubelet组件数据 使用alertmanager实现监控报警 使用grafana实现数据可视化 1、部署metrics-server git clone https://github.com/cuishuaigit/k8s-monitor.git cd k8s-monitor 我都是把这种服务部署在master节点上面,此时需要修改metrics-server-deployment.yaml ...